A set of two hand taps designed for the production of G-type cylindrical pipe threads (BSPP) in accordance with DIN 5157. Tools made of high-speed HSS steel, designed for precise hole machining in workshop and industrial applications.

Taps allow for the production of threads with high accuracy and repeatability, especially in components that require subsequent assembly with the use of seals (e.g. washers, O-rings).

Design and principle of operation

The 2-piece set includes taps with different working geometries:

  • pre-tap (coarse) – responsible for starting the threading process and guiding the tool,
  • Finishing tap – Sets the target profile and thread accuracy.

The use of straight chip grooves enables stable operation in through-holes and general workshop applications.

Thread characteristics

The thread made with these tools is a cylindrical thread, which means that:

  • does not ensure self-sealing of the connection,
  • requires the use of a sealing element (e.g. washer, o-ring),
  • ensures high repeatability and the possibility of multiple installation.

What threads are these taps designed for?

The taps are used to make G-type cylindrical pipe threads (BSPP), compliant with DIN 5157. These are threads used in hydraulic and pneumatic systems, where tightness is achieved through additional sealing, not the thread itself.

Is the thread made with this tap tight?

No. A G-type thread is a cylindrical thread that does not provide a self-sealing connection. A gasket, washer or o-ring is required to achieve tightness.

What is the difference between a cylindrical (G) and a tapered (R) thread?

The cylindrical thread (G) has a fixed diameter and is responsible for the connection of the components, while the tapered thread (R) narrows and can seal the connection by itself by wedging the components.

Why does the set consist of two taps?

The kit includes a pre-tap (the so-called stripper), which starts the cutting process and guides the tool, and a finishing tap (finisher), which gives the final profile and thread accuracy. This increases precision and reduces the risk of tool damage.

Can you use only one tap in the kit?

This is not recommended. Skipping the pre-step (stripper) increases the load on the finishing tool and can lead to faster wear or damage, especially with larger thread diameters.

What materials are these taps suitable for?

Taps made of HSS steel are suitable for machining mild steel, tool steel, stainless steel (with the right lubricant) and non-ferrous metals.

Should I use oil when threading?

Yes. The use of threading oil significantly reduces friction, improves the quality of the thread surface, facilitates chip evacuation and extends tool life.

Are these taps suitable for machine work?

These taps are designed mainly for manual work. In some cases, they can be used in machines, but this requires an appropriate handle and control of operating parameters.

How to avoid breaking the tap during operation?

Use the right oil, perform retractable movements to break chips, and avoid excessive loading. It is particularly important to guide the tap axially to the bore.

Is the thread made with this tool reusable?

Yes. G-type cylindrical threads provide high repeatability and allow multiple assembly and disassembly, provided the appropriate sealing element is used.

Symbol Number of turns per inch Thread hole diameter (mm) Overall length (mm) Working Length (mm)
G1/8 28 8.8 63 18
G1/4 19 11.8 70 20
G3/8 19 15.25 70 20
G1/2 14 19 80 22
G3/4 14 24.5 90 22
G1 11 30.75 100 25
